Rafael T. · Reviewed about 1 year ago
Lab cannot be completed. It tries to create a Composer version 1 instance, but that reached end of life in March, and GCP will not allow it. I tried to manually create version 2, but it took more than an hour and wrote ZONE_RESOURCE_POOL_EXHAUSTED errors to the log. This lab either needs to be redone to work with version 2, or converted into a video that removes the wait times.
